Skip to content
Crittografia simmetrica e asimmetrica
Sistemi e reti · 5a Liceo · Sicurezza delle Reti e Crittografia · 2.º Período

Crittografia simmetrica e asimmetrica

Studio degli algoritmi a chiave segreta e a chiave pubblica, con focus su standard come AES e RSA.

In sintesi:La crittografia è il motore invisibile che garantisce la privacy e la fiducia nell'era digitale. In questo modulo, gli studenti approfondiscono la distinzione tra algoritmi simmetrici (come AES), veloci ma con il problema dello scambio della chiave, e asimmetrici (come RSA), che risolvono la distribuzione delle chiavi a scapito della velocità. Si analizza come la matematica delle funzioni unidirezionali permetta di proteggere transazioni bancarie e comunicazioni personali.

Traguardi per lo Sviluppo delle CompetenzeMIUR, Istituti Tecnici, Informatica e Telecomunicazioni, Sistemi e Reti (5° anno): Conoscenze - Algoritmi di crittografia simmetrica e asimmetricaMIUR, Istituti Tecnici, Informatica e Telecomunicazioni: Abilità - Applicare tecniche crittografiche per la protezione dei dati

Informazioni su questo argomento

La crittografia è il motore invisibile che garantisce la privacy e la fiducia nell'era digitale. In questo modulo, gli studenti approfondiscono la distinzione tra algoritmi simmetrici (come AES), veloci ma con il problema dello scambio della chiave, e asimmetrici (come RSA), che risolvono la distribuzione delle chiavi a scapito della velocità. Si analizza come la matematica delle funzioni unidirezionali permetta di proteggere transazioni bancarie e comunicazioni personali.

Il programma prevede lo studio degli approcci ibridi, che combinano il meglio dei due mondi. Gli studenti non si limitano a studiare le formule, ma comprendono l'applicazione pratica nei protocolli moderni. Questo argomento è ideale per attività di problem-solving e sfide logiche, dove la comprensione dei concetti matematici si traduce in soluzioni di sicurezza reali, preparando gli studenti alle sfide tecniche dei sistemi informatici complessi.

Domande chiave

  1. Qual è la differenza fondamentale tra chiave simmetrica e asimmetrica?
  2. Come funziona matematicamente l'algoritmo RSA?
  3. Quali sono i vantaggi di un approccio crittografico ibrido?

Attenzione a questi errori comuni

Errore comunePensare che la crittografia asimmetrica sia 'migliore' di quella simmetrica in assoluto.

Cosa insegnare invece

Entrambe hanno scopi diversi. Quella asimmetrica è lenta e usata per lo scambio chiavi o firme; quella simmetrica è veloce e usata per i dati. L'uso di metafore fisiche (lucchetti vs chiavi di casa) aiuta a chiarire i contesti d'uso.

Errore comuneCredere che un messaggio cifrato sia impossibile da decifrare per sempre.

Cosa insegnare invece

La sicurezza crittografica è basata sulla complessità computazionale. Con l'aumento della potenza di calcolo (o il futuro calcolo quantistico), alcuni algoritmi diventano obsoleti. Discussioni su questo tema aiutano a capire il concetto di 'sicurezza nel tempo'.

Idee di apprendimento attivo

Vedi tutte le attività

Domande frequenti

Perché non usiamo solo la crittografia asimmetrica per tutto?
Perché è estremamente pesante dal punto di vista computazionale (fino a 1000 volte più lenta della simmetrica). Per questo si usa solo per scambiare una chiave simmetrica, che poi verrà usata per cifrare il traffico dati vero e proprio.
Cos'è una funzione hash e perché è diversa dalla crittografia?
La crittografia è bidirezionale (posso cifrare e decifrare). L'hash è una funzione unidirezionale che genera un'impronta digitale fissa di un file. Non si può tornare al file originale dall'hash; serve per verificare l'integrità, non per nascondere dati.
Quali sono i vantaggi di un approccio attivo nell'insegnamento della crittografia?
La crittografia può sembrare pura matematica astratta. Attraverso simulazioni fisiche (scambio di chiavi, decifrazione di codici) e l'uso di software di cifratura, gli studenti visualizzano il flusso dei dati e comprendono la logica dei protocolli. Questo rende i concetti di 'chiave pubblica' e 'privata' intuitivi anziché puramente mnemonici.
Cos'è l'algoritmo RSA in parole semplici?
È un sistema basato sulla difficoltà di fattorizzare numeri primi molto grandi. Usa una chiave pubblica per 'chiudere' il messaggio (che chiunque può avere) e una chiave privata per 'aprirlo' (che solo il destinatario possiede).
Edited by Adriana Perusin, Editor-in-Chief, Flip Education